Centrally Managed
When working in conjunction with D-Link Wireless Controllers, the
DWL-8620APE can be centrally managed. This allows for a large number of
access points to be deployed and managed easily and eciently. Once the APs
are discovered by the controller, the administrator can push the conguration
to them as a group, instead of conguring each access point individually.
Additionally, Radio Frequency (RF) resource management
1
allows wireless
coverage to be managed centrally, providing the best coverage possible for
wireless clients.
Automatic Radio Frequency (RF) Management
When access points are deployed in close proximity to each other, there may
be interference between channels if RF management is not implemented.
When the DWL-8620APE senses a neighbour nearby, it will automatically
select a non-interfering channel. This greatly reduces RF interference and
will allow the administrator to deploy APs more densely. To further minimise
interference, when a nearby AP is on the same channel, the DWL-8620APE will
automatically lower its transmission power
1
. When, for whatever reason, the
nearby AP is no longer present, the access point will increase its transmission
power to expand coverage.
Advanced Wireless Features
The DDWL-8620APE support 802.1p Quality of Service (QoS) for enhanced
throughput and better performance of time-sensitive trac like VoIP and
streaming DSCP. It also supports Wi-Fi Multimedia (WMM), so in the event of
network congestion, time-sensitive trac can be given priority ahead of other
trac. Furthermore, when a number of access points are in close proximity
to each other, an access point will refuse new association requests once its
resources are fully utilised, allowing the association request to be picked up
by a neighbouring unit, distributing the load over multiple APs. Band steering
technology enables the DWL-8620APE to intelligently place clients on the
optimal wireless band to avoid congestion and allows for smooth streaming
of video, seamless browsing, and fast downloads for mobile devices. Airtime
Fairness ensures that equal airtime is given to each client, providing increased
performance even if slower devices are connected. 802.11k Fast Roaming
1
is
also supported, which allows the wireless client to roam seamlessly between
access points.
